Forensic science plays a crucial role in the examination of crime scenes and the collection of evidence, including items such as garments, cigarette remnants, and biological samples, to scientifically establish a suspect’s culpability. DNA testing in cases of assault and homicide is instrumental in verifying the identity of the victim. This evidence significantly aids in expediting both the investigative process and judicial proceedings. However, forensic science is not without its limitations and inherent constraints. Therefore, initial investigators, including the Crime Laboratory Ultimate Evidence System team and forensic specialists, must be aware of these limitations when collecting and analyzing samples to avoid inaccurate findings. Erroneous outcomes can result from inadequate sample sizes, improper collection techniques, or delayed analyses. The enforcement of standardized procedural protocols is essential; without them, the legal admissibility of forensic evidence to conclusively establish guilt is compromised. Consequently, the judiciary may acquit the defendant, extending the benefit of the doubt. This article examines the role and limitations of forensic science within the Indian Criminal Justice System and emphasizes the necessity of adhering to established procedures to obtain reliable results.
